Output 2002ec29bf31534975ac72e10fa70173d240e7172012f4f5739861abebbf680d:0

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63897f5943494bed0296dc16bd91aa6d9868e51c4cbf57723a2f41a3ac7c3cd3
address
bc1pvwyh7k2rf9976q5kmsttmyd2dkvx3egufjl4wu369aq68tru8nfsen8z9m
transaction
2002ec29bf31534975ac72e10fa70173d240e7172012f4f5739861abebbf680d
spent
true